Asset and Compliance Administrative Officer
Location: Lyndhurst (Hybrid/Worksmart Policy)
Salary: £35,646 per annum, pro rata (£18.48/hour)
Contract: Temporary to start ASAP until 31st December 2026
Hours: Full-time
The Role
We are looking for a detail-oriented professional to provide vital administrative and technical support to Housing Maintenance and Compliance teams. This is a high-impact role ensuring housing assets remain safe and compliant with statutory regulations.
Key Responsibilities
* Compliance Support: Assist in managing cyclical servicing and statutory inspection regimes.
* Data Management: Maintain accurate records for service contracts, health and safety files, and contractor performance.
* Complaint Handling: Support the service by gathering evidence, creating timelines, and drafting responses to customer queries.
* Flexible Operations: Support the Customer Service and Operational Planning teams with telephone, web, and email contact as required.
* Reporting: Help develop and produce regular assurance reports for statutory compliance.
What You’ll Need
* Experience: At least 3 years in a busy office environment, ideally within building maintenance or social housing.
* Education: BTEC National Diploma in Business Studies or NVQ Level 3 equivalent.
* Technical Skills: Excellent ICT skills (Microsoft Office) and a basic understanding of building construction or asbestos/CDM legislation.
* Soft Skills: Strong interpersonal skills for dealing with tenants, contractors, and internal staff.
Requirements
* An enhanced DBS check is required for this position.
